Clean Pumpkin Muffins!

'Tis the season for all things pumpkin! In addition to Fall flavor, pumpkin is high in Vitamin A, Vitamin C, fiber, potassium, magnesium, iron, folate, Vitamin E, and Vitamin B6! Here's a clean and healthy way to enjoy pumpkin, and all it's traditional seasonings without added sugars!

Ingredients:
-2c Old Fashioned Oats
-1, 8oz can Pumpkin Puree (or make your own!)
​-2, ripe bananas
-1/2c unsweetened applesauce
-2 eggs
-1/4c canola oil or butter
-1 tbs. cinnamon (or more to taste)
-1 tsp. each of: vanilla extract, ginger, allspice, ground clove (or more to taste)

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Start by placing the oats in a food processor long enough to create a flour-like texture (30-sec to 1-minute). Then add all remaining ingredients, and blend until smooth (this will be a normal muffin-batter consistency).

Scoop batter into greased muffin tin (or baking or loaf pan to make a sliceable treat). You can fill muffin tins to the top, this recipe does not contain yeast or baking soda, and will not rise much. 

Bake 30 mins, or until to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Let cool 5 minutes, and enjoy warm! These are especially delicious with butter on top!
